Stillwater High School senior Anthony Zazzaro places second in Class C Cross-Country Championships
Congratulations to Stillwater High School senior Anthony Zazzaro on placing second in the Section 2 Class C Cross-Country Championships! On Saturday, Nov. 9, Anthony competed in the boys 5000 meter run finals in Queensbury and finished with a time of 15:50.30. Girls varsity soccer team wins back to back championships; advances to NYSPHSAA Class C Final Four
Congratulations to the girls varsity soccer team on winning the Class C Sectional Championship and Regional Championship! The team has been on an unstoppable winning streak, having first claimed the sectional championship against Lake George on Nov. 6, followed by the regional title on Nov. 9 against Lisbon Central High School. Girls varsity volleyball wins first Class C Sectional Championship
Congratulations to the girls varsity volleyball team on winning the Class C Sectional Championship for the first time in Stillwater High School history! The team valiantly defeated Galway 3-1 on Saturday, Nov. 9 to secure their first sectional championship title, ending their Wasaren League season with an outstanding 13-0 record. Freshmen pay it forward on Give Back Day
On Thursday, Oct. 3, Stillwater High School freshmen traded in their textbooks for rakes, trash bags, pencils, and scrub brushes to venture into Saratoga County as part of Give Back Day.
